Book Description

Great value omnibus of the first three titles in the hugely successful Roman Mysteries series: THE THIEVES OF OSTIA, THE SECRETS OF VESUVIUS and THE PIRATES OF POMPEII.

With a rrp of £10 this book, with the first three Roman Mysteries combined into one volume, is an ideal christmas present for a child who loves to read.
The books included in this omnibus take the four friends, Flavia, jonathon, Nubia and Lupus on a thrilling adventure as they foil the plans of Ostia's latest villain, a dog killer, escape the deadly erruption of Mount Vesuvius and battle against a troupe of sinister pirates.
A must have for kids of all ages. Not only does it provide an exciting read, but teaches children about the Roman lifestyle in such a way that kids wont see it as learning. Learning, they'll think, couldnt possibly be this good!

For those who have never read any of The Roman Mysteries by Caroline Lawrence, this is a great place to begin.

Here the first three books have been combined in one title:

1. THE THIEVES OF OSTIA

The first book sets the scene of how life was like in the tumultuous 1st century AD. The main character Flavia finds the friends that are to accompany her on their first adventure

2. THE SECRETS OF VESUVIUS

The second book begins with Jonathan, Flavia, Lupus and Nubia staying at Flavia's uncle's farm. That sounds fine...except the year is 79 AD and they are near Mount Vesuvius before it blows. Animals act strangely and birds mysteriously die as a warning of what is about to come. Added to that children are also going missing. Flavia and the others get firmly engaged into discovering what is really going on and in saving people from the volcano when it finally explodes.

3. THE PIRATES OF POMPEII

Just as with modern disasters, refugees from the eruption at Pompeii find themselves aving to find shelter in refugee camps. The young heroes also have to deal with a mystery as to why children are going missing.

The three books are well researched and great entertainment .
